Guinea Bissau: AfDB Announces $30 Million Package For Infrastructure, Budget And Governance Support

Dr Akinwumi A. Adesina - President of the AfDB Group

The African Development Bank Group (AfDB) has announced a financial package of 30 million dollars to the West African nation of Guinea-Bissau.

The Bank Group President, Dr. Akinwumi A. Adesina, revealed this during a visit to Bissau, where he met President Umaro Sissoco Embaló and senior government officials.

Discussions covered a range of strategic issues, including strengthening the already close cooperation between the African Development Bank and the Government of Guinea-Bissau, as well as ongoing and future Bank-financed strategic projects to support the country’s economic transformation.

Dr. Adesina explained that out of the $30 million earmarked for financing of projects in Guinea-Bissau, $14 million would be allocated to building road networks between Guinea Bissau and Senegal, while $8.7 million and $7 million would go to budget support and capacity building, and government reforms, respectively.

“I want to assure President Embaló of the African Development Bank’s firm commitment to support his vision for the country and the government’s program. The African Development Bank will stay here to give you support”.

Dr. Adesina

Dr Akinwumi A. Adesina congratulated President Embaló on his achievements and for what he described as the president’s exceptional leadership, especially in Guinea-Bissau’s management of the Covid-19 crisis. Adesina said Guinea-Bissau has achieved an African record in ensuring that 70% of the country’s population over 18 were vaccinated.

On his part, President Sissoco Embaló stated that for many years, Guinea-Bissau has been affected by political disruptions that have hampered the country’s development.

“This is the first time we have government stability, and we have to make use of it to accelerate economic transformation. We are grateful that the African Development Bank has always been by our side, even during difficult times. We are ready to work alongside the Bank to lead Guinea-Bissau to a new chapter of its history”.

President Sissoco Embaló

Implementation of the project

The African Development Bank (AfDB) plans to set up a delivery unit to speed up project implementation. The Bank financed the establishment of the National School of Administration to improve the performance of economic and financial arms of public administration, as well as project management and monitoring. 

Adesina’s visit coincided with the launch of an African Development Bank-supported project to support the empowerment and financial inclusion of women and youth engaged in cashew nut, fruit and vegetable production.

Guinea-Bissau’s agriculture-based economy is dependent on cashew nut exports and has been hit hard by the Covid-19 pandemic. The country is currently pursuing a robust program to increase production and make better use of agricultural value chains, professionalize cooperatives and improve their access to financing.

GDP growth in Guinea-Bissau contracted by 2.8% in 2020, halting the positive growth rate the country had experienced since 2015. Economic recovery, however, is expected in 2022, with the resumption of trade activities and large-scale vaccination against Covid-19.
